
المشاركة الأصلية كتبت بواسطة أبو فيصل
السلام عليكم
هناك مشكلة واجهت الكثيرين من أصحاب المواقع العربية خصوصا بعد ترقية برنامج phpmyadmin في إستضافاتهم مما جعلهم لايستطيعون مشاهدة اللغة العربية في البرنامج والآن نحتاج الى حل أبدي.
هناك حلول أخرى مما لاشك فيه ولكن تنقصنا الخبرة وأحد الحلول وضعها الأخ فوقا هنا في منتديات سوالف وذلك بإستخدام إصدار قديم للبرنامج المذكور.
مارأيكم لو إستخدمنا الترميز UTF-8 بدلا من windows-1256 في السكربتات المستخدمة في مواقعنا .
مثال:
لنفترض أننا نستخدم مجلة phpnuke
نقوم بتغيير الترميز في ملفات اللغة من windows-1256 الى UTF-8 حتى نشاهد المشاركات الجديدة في برنامج phpmyadmin باللغة العربية بدون علامات إستفهام أو طلاسم
طبعا بعد التغيير لن يتم مشاهدة المشاركات القديمة باللغة العربية بسبب أنها أدخلت بالترميز السابق windows-1256 ولحل المشكلة هنا برنامج يقوم بتحويل الترميز الى الترميز الجديد
UTF-8 أي أنك لابد أن تأخذ نسخة من قاعدة البيانات وتستخدم البرنامج في تحويلها الى الترميز الجديد UTF-8 ومن ثم زراعتها وبعد ذلك تمتع بمشاهدة اللغة العربية في البرنامج.
اليكم نبذة عن البرنامج باللغة الإنجليزية :
Encoding Master
A small utility for dealing with the numerous text encodings there are in the modern computing world. If you are in a mess with text encodings, Encoding Master could help! It can convert text in ShiftJIS to UTF16LE, or MacArabic to WinArabic, or WinHebrew to UTF8, or anything to anything else! (at least where it concerns text encodings).
Features:
Can convert text from any TextEncoding, to any other TextEncoding.
Batch processes TextEncodings on as many files as you like, in one go. Even files in different folders.
User Safety is highest in the mind. No original files are over-written. Converted files are stored in a folder next to the originals.
Converts text in the clipboard.
Conversion has a "preview" window, which allows you to make sure that you know how your text will turn out.
Can strip, or add Unicode BOMs to files.
Batch verification of Unicode files. Tells you if the file is proper Unicode, or not.
Can convert filenames, may be useful when moving files from one file system to another, when one file system's default encoding is different than the others.
UTF-8 repairing, can repair invalid UTF-8 files.
Nice intuitive, clean and simple interface.
PC and Mac!
صورة البرنامج :
لتحميل البرنامج من الرابط التالي:
http://www.elfdata.com/encodingmaste...Master.exe.zip
وإليكم موضوع نجح أحد الأخوان بتحويل منتديات phpbb الى الترميز UTF-8
http://forum.moffed.com/bb/about1334.html
وهذا نص للأخ : الباهي يقول في أحد المشاركات:
من واقع التجربة البرنامج افلح بشكل ممتاز بتحويل ملفات اللغة وقاعدة البيانات. بسرعة مذهلة
وأخيرا
مع خالص شكري وتقديري للأخوان
الباهي وInterNet وAC ومطنوخ من
منتديات مفيد . كوم
والأخ العزيز هاوي php من
شبكة 24 /24 العربية
لإستفادتي منهم في عدة دروس
وجزاكم الله خيرا